CC-1927: Remove PEAR DB

Fixed all install/upgrade scripts.
This commit is contained in:
paul.baranowski 2012-04-01 23:39:15 -04:00 committed by Martin Konecny
parent 7f78a7f663
commit 95d69a3bbe
17 changed files with 351 additions and 2140 deletions

View file

@ -17,7 +17,7 @@ require_once "DateHelper.php";
require_once "OsPath.php";
require_once __DIR__.'/controllers/plugins/RabbitMqPlugin.php';
global $CC_CONFIG, $CC_DBC;
global $CC_CONFIG; //, $CC_DBC;
$dsn = $CC_CONFIG['dsn'];
// ******************************************************************
@ -27,6 +27,7 @@ $dsn = $CC_CONFIG['dsn'];
// PDO returns false
// ******************************************************************
// $CC_DBC = DB::connect($dsn, FALSE);
// if (PEAR::isError($CC_DBC)) {
// echo "ERROR: ".$CC_DBC->getMessage()." ".$CC_DBC->getUserInfo()."\n";
@ -41,9 +42,14 @@ $dsn = $CC_CONFIG['dsn'];
// $result = $CC_DBC->GetOne($sql);
// var_dump($result);
// $con = Propel::getConnection();
// $q = $con->query($sql);
// //var_dump($q);
// $sql = "SELECT 1";
// try {
// $con = Propel::getConnection();
// //$q = $con->query($sql);
// } catch (Exception $e) {
// var_dump($e);
// }
// var_dump($q);
// //var_dump($q->fetchAll());
// var_dump($q->fetchColumn(0));

View file

@ -7,7 +7,7 @@
* our custom changes requires the database parameters to be loaded from /etc/airtime/airtime.conf so
* that the user can customize these.
*/
global $CC_CONFIG;
@ -17,12 +17,12 @@ $dbuser = $CC_CONFIG['dsn']['username'];
$dbpass = $CC_CONFIG['dsn']['password'];
$conf = array (
'datasources' =>
'datasources' =>
array (
'airtime' =>
'airtime' =>
array (
'adapter' => 'pgsql',
'connection' =>
'connection' =>
array (
'dsn' => "pgsql:host=$dbhost;port=5432;dbname=$dbname;user=$dbuser;password=$dbpass",
),